Understanding Vascular and Vein Disorders: A Critical Aspect of Overall Health
Vascular disorders encompass a diverse range of health issues affecting the arteries, veins, and lymphatic vessels—crucial components of the circulatory system that sustain the body's vital functions. Left untreated, these conditions can lead to serious complications, including pain, swelling, skin changes, ulcers, and even life-threatening events such as strokes or limb ischemia.

The Role of Vascular and Vein Specialists in Modern Medicine
Expertise in Diagnosis and Evaluation
Accurate diagnosis is the cornerstone of effective vascular care. Vascular and vein specialists utilize advanced diagnostic tools such as duplex ultrasonography, angiography, and magnetic resonance vascular imaging to assess blood flow, identify blockages, and evaluate venous insufficiency. These detailed assessments form the basis for crafting personalized treatment strategies.
Innovative Treatment Strategies for Vascular Conditions
With a focus on minimally invasive procedures, modern vascular and vein specialists employ cutting-edge techniques such as endovenous laser therapy, sclerotherapy, radiofrequency ablation, and microphlebectomies. These procedures effectively treat varicose veins, spider veins, arterial blockages, and other vascular issues with minimal discomfort and downtime.
Ongoing Management and Preventive Care
Preventing progression or recurrence of vascular disease involves comprehensive management, including lifestyle modifications, pharmacologic therapy, and routine monitoring. Vascular and vein specialists work closely with patients to implement preventative measures, reducing the risk of complications and promoting long-term vascular health.
Significance of Specialized Vascular Medicine for Different Patient Needs
- Patients with Venous Insufficiency: Chronic leg swelling, heaviness, and discomfort often indicate venous reflux or insufficiency. Specialist intervention can alleviate symptoms, prevent ulcer formation, and restore natural circulation.
- People suffering from Varicose Veins: Beyond cosmetic concerns, varicose veins can cause pain, skin discoloration, and serious health risks. Experts provide effective treatment options to eliminate visible veins and improve venous function.
- Individuals with Arterial Disease: Blockages in arteries, such as peripheral artery disease (PAD), threaten limb viability and overall health. Vascular specialists offer advanced therapies to restore blood flow and prevent tissue loss.
- Post-Surgical or Post-Trauma Care: Vascular specialists also manage recovery, healing, and long-term vascular health following surgeries or traumatic injuries involving blood vessels.

Comprehensive Treatment Options Offered by Vascular and Vein Specialists
Minimally Invasive Procedures
Advances in minimally invasive techniques have revolutionized vascular treatment, enabling outpatient procedures with minimal discomfort:
- Endovenous Laser Therapy (EVLT): A highly effective method for closing diseased veins, often used for varicose vein treatment.
- Sclerotherapy: Injection of a sclerosant solution to collapse and seal problematic veins, suitable for spider and small varicose veins.
- Radiofrequency Ablation: Uses heat energy to close off malfunctioning veins, restoring normal blood flow.
- Microphlebectomy: Removal of large varicose veins via tiny skin incisions, providing quick recovery and cosmetic results.
Advanced Medical Interventions
For more complex vascular diseases, such as arterial blockages or deep vein thrombosis (DVT), vascular and vein specialists may employ:
- Angioplasty and Stenting: Opening blocked arteries with balloons and placing stents to maintain blood flow.
- Thrombolytic Therapy: Using clot-busting medications to dissolve dangerous blood clots.
- Bypass Surgery: Creating alternate pathways for blood flow around severely obstructed vessels, often performed in specialized centers.
Optimizing Vascular and Vein Health: Lifestyle Tips and Preventive Strategies
Beyond medical interventions, lifestyle modifications play a vital role in maintaining vascular health:
- Regular Exercise: Promotes circulation, strengthens vascular walls, and reduces the risk of clot formation.
- Healthy Diet: Emphasizes f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and whole grains to support cardiovascular health.
- Weight Management: Maintaining an ideal weight lessens strain on the veins and arteries.
- Avoiding Prolonged Sitting or Standing: Encourages movement to prevent blood pooling and venous stasis.
- Smoking Cessation: Reduces vascular inflammation and arterial damage.
The Future of Vascular and Vein Treatment: Innovations and Emerging Technologies
The field of vascular medicine continues to evolve rapidly, driven by technological innovations. Emerging therapies include:
- Gene Therapy: Potential to address underlying causes of vascular diseases at the molecular level.
- Nanotechnology: Targeted drug delivery systems to improve treatment efficacy with fewer side effects.
- Artificial Intelligence (AI): Enhances diagnostic accuracy and personalizes treatment algorithms.
- Regenerative Medicine: Promising research into biologic grafts and stem cell therapies for vascular tissue repair and regeneration.
